Latest Patents

Franz-Joseph Foltz holds a patent for "Methods and systems for exhaust gas recirculation cooler regeneration." This patent outlines various methods and systems for regenerating an exhaust gas recirculation cooler. One example method includes initiating an EGR cooler regeneration mode, which involves changing the fuel distribution of a donor cylinder group relative to a non-donor cylinder group of an engine. Additionally, it emphasizes increasing at least one of the engine speed or load of the engine. This innovation is crucial for improving the performance and sustainability of modern engines.
